“Interesting to reflect on the good old days”a reader tells Topical. “I have been reading about Australian ore-carrying ships sunk off Australia’s east coast by Japanese submarines in World War 2” he said. “In accordance with standard practice in the era, BHP stopped the survivors’ pay from one ship, the Iron Knight, the moment ship was sunk. The company gave the survivors 30 days’ unpaid leave after the sinking, but deducted their time adrift in the raft from that 30 days.”
